#37437d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37437d is composed of 21.6% red, 26.3%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 229.7 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 35.3%. #37437d color hex could be obtained by blending #6e86f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#37437d color description : Dark moderate blue.

#37437d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#37437d has RGB values of R:55, G:67,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3621757.

Shades and Tints of #37437d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#37437d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5a5a is the less saturated color, while #0723ad is the most saturated one.
